## Holiday-Period Opening Hours — Marlow Point Building

During the winter closure (24 Dec–2 Jan), Marlow Point operates reduced hours: 08:00–16:00 on working days only. The main turnstiles lock outside these times, and the facilities desk should direct all out-of-hours requests through the duty supervisor. Cleaning crews from Osterfield Services retain scheduled access. For staff needing entry via the east door during the closure, use the badge code provided below.

staff pass of tahag-bahop = bdg-VBPZJ-1

**Q: Which linter does Cobblewire enforce on `.sql` files?**

A: All plugins submitted to the Cobblewire registry pass through `sqlgate`, our in-house linter. Rules: uppercase keywords, no `SELECT *`, explicit join conditions, and a 120-character line cap. Rule overrides require a `.sqlgate.toml` in your plugin root. Custom rule packs must be signed before publication. Signing happens on the Lorris build host, and unlocking the signing store there requires the recovery passphrase shown directly below.

vault phrase of bagaf-kajeg = jorath-feniel-briir-siliel-ralix

Ticket #88: Badge system migration, night-shift notice. Over the weekend, Fenwick Row is moving from the old Keystone readers to the new Ardale panels. Night staff should expect the lift lobby readers to be offline between 01:00 and 04:00 on Saturday. During this window, use the stairwell doors only, and log every entry in the paper register at the guard desk. Legacy badges will stop working once the cutover completes. Until your replacement badge arrives, the night crew should use the interim code below.

door code, yageg-yagap: bdg-DNN-9

Our FrillGate edge service enables websocket compression by default, and under load the deflate contexts balloon memory until connections start failing. We're weighing disabling compression entirely (more bandwidth, fewer drops) versus per-message context takeover limits. Also aware compression on secrets-bearing frames has CRIME-style implications, so your call matters here. Repro steps are attached; the failures also cascade to our session store. To inspect the affected session tables directly, connect with the string below.

primary connection of yagep-kahip = redis://giliel_svc:zYiKsLL2PLpfPL@db-348f.xolmarsys.corp:5432/fenwyn